Vertical Gardening Solutions for Small Areas

Vertical gardening is an innovative and efficient way to maximize green space in small areas. By growing plants upwards rather than outwards, it transforms limited spaces into lush, productive gardens. This approach not only optimizes the use of space but also adds aesthetic value and promotes sustainable living in urban environments. Whether for herbs, flowers, or vegetables, vertical gardens are versatile solutions for balconies, patios, walls, and any confined outdoor or indoor areas.

Benefits of Vertical Gardening in Small Spaces

Maximizing Limited Space with Vertical Structures

Utilizing vertical structures such as trellises, wall-mounted planters, and stacked containers can dramatically increase planting capacity. These structures leverage unused vertical surfaces, converting them into productive growing areas without occupying precious floor space. By training climbing plants or arranging pots vertically, gardeners can cultivate a variety of species where ground space is scarce. This method is especially beneficial for urban dwellers who have balconies or limited patio areas, enabling them to enjoy the benefits of gardening regardless of the size constraints.

Enhancing Aesthetic Appeal and Privacy

Vertical gardens serve as living walls, creating natural green backdrops that beautify small spaces while adding privacy. These installations can soften hard surfaces, cover unsightly walls, and introduce vibrant colors and textures. By carefully selecting plants with varying foliage and flowers, vertical gardens become dynamic, eye-catching features. Privacy is enhanced as these vertical plantings act as natural screens that shield outdoor seating areas or windows from neighbors, making small open spaces more intimate and comfortable.

Improving Air Quality and Environment

Plants in vertical gardens contribute to better air quality by filtering pollutants and increasing oxygen levels. In densely populated urban areas, where outdoor air can be compromised, vertical plants act as green lungs that mitigate environmental toxins. These gardens also help regulate humidity levels and reduce noise pollution by absorbing sound. Incorporating vertical gardens into small spaces supports a healthier living environment, boosting both physical well-being and mental health through closer interaction with nature.

Choosing the Right Plants for Vertical Gardens

Climbing plants like ivy, sweet peas, or morning glories are naturally suited for vertical growth. Their tendrils and stems can grip trellises or wall-mounted supports, allowing them to ascend and cover space efficiently. Trailing plants such as pothos or creeping fig also adapt well, cascading over edges of containers or shelves to add lush greenery. These plants are relatively easy to maintain and can adapt to various indoor or outdoor conditions, making them perfect choices for small vertical gardens.

Vertical Gardening Materials and Tools

Frames, Containers, and Supports

Frames made from materials like wood, metal, or plastic provide the backbone of vertical gardens. Containers should be lightweight yet sturdy, often equipped with adequate drainage holes to prevent waterlogging. Supports such as trellises or mesh aid climbing plants by guiding their growth upwards. Selecting weather-resistant materials ensures longevity, especially for outdoor vertical gardens exposed to sun and rain. Modular container designs allow customization and expansion as gardening needs evolve.

Soil and Growing Mediums

Soil selection is critical in vertical gardening since roots have limited room to spread. Lightweight, well-draining potting mixes designed for container planting reduce water retention issues and nutrient depletion. Adding organic matter such as compost enhances fertility and moisture retention. Alternative growing mediums like coconut coir or sphagnum moss may be used for specific plant types or hydroponic vertical gardens, improving aeration and root support.

Watering Systems and Tools

Efficient watering is vital for vertical gardens to ensure all plants receive adequate hydration without waste. Drip irrigation or self-watering planters automate moisture delivery and reduce manual effort, particularly in hard-to-reach vertical setups. Handheld watering cans with narrow spouts allow targeted watering and minimize runoff. Using moisture meters helps monitor soil dampness, preventing over- or underwatering, which are common challenges in vertical gardening.

Installation and Maintenance Practices

Assessing location factors including sunlight exposure, wind conditions, and available wall or fence surfaces is essential before installation. Preparing the site involves cleaning surfaces, installing anchors or hooks, and assembling vertical modules according to design. Ensuring secure fixation prevents accidents or plant damage caused by wind or weight shifts. Planting should start gradually to allow roots to establish before the entire vertical garden is populated, avoiding overburdening the structure initially.

Creative Vertical Garden Designs

Living Walls and Green Screens

Living walls utilize panels or grids mounted on vertical surfaces to support an array of plants planted closely together, creating dense green coverage. These walls can be customized with geometric patterns or gradients of colors and textures for striking visual effects. Green screens made from climbing plants offer more flexibility as they cover fences or frames, providing a lush, natural backdrop that can also function as privacy filters.

Modular Systems and Pocket Planters

Modular vertical garden systems consist of interlocking containers or pockets that can be arranged in various configurations. This flexibility allows gardeners to adapt layouts according to plant needs or available space. Pocket planters made from fabrics or recycled materials offer lightweight options that are easy to hang on walls or fences. These systems facilitate focused growing environments for different species while enhancing overall design cohesion.

Incorporating Art and Functional Elements

Vertical gardens can integrate artistic features such as painted pots, sculptural plant supports, or decorative lighting to elevate the space’s ambiance. Functional additions like small benches or fold-out tables attached to garden frames make vertical gardens part of active living areas. By blending utility with creativity, these gardens serve not only as green spaces but also as inspiring outdoor rooms or interior design elements.

Overcoming Challenges in Vertical Gardening

Water distribution can be uneven in vertical gardens, causing some plants to dry out while others become waterlogged. Installing drip irrigation or self-watering systems ensures consistent moisture delivery. Using well-draining soil and containers with adequate drainage holes prevents root rot. Positioning vertical gardens where excess water can freely drain away minimizes potential damage to walls or surfaces behind the installation.

Sustainable Practices in Vertical Gardening

Using Recycled and Natural Materials

Repurposing materials like pallets, old containers, or natural fibers for vertical garden construction minimizes waste and reduces ecological footprints. Choosing sustainably sourced wood or biodegradable components fosters environmentally friendly gardening. These materials add character and uniqueness to vertical gardens while aligning with green living principles, promoting conscious consumption and creative reuse.

Water Conservation Techniques

Implementing rainwater harvesting systems or using greywater for vertical garden irrigation conserves potable water supplies. Drip irrigation and self-watering containers reduce water loss through evaporation and runoff. Mulching around plant roots within containers also helps retain moisture. Efficient water use practices not only preserve resources but contribute to healthier plant growth in often challenging urban growing conditions.

Organic Pest and Nutrient Management

Avoiding chemical pesticides and synthetic fertilizers protects beneficial insects, soil microorganisms, and local wildlife. Organic pest control methods such as companion planting, natural predators, and homemade sprays effectively manage harmful species without environmental damage. Using compost, manure, and organic amendments enriches soil fertility naturally, supporting sustainable plant production that aligns with holistic urban agriculture goals.
